About Me


Born in the Washington D.C area and raised in Northern Virginia. First heard music a bit like Bluegrass at the Cellar Door in Washington at a performance of "The Star Spangled Washboard Band." Moved on to Colorado where he lived for 10 years. During that time Bob was introduced to Real Bluegrass in Green Mountain Falls. Stumbling upon a new friend while moving he discovered a world that changed his life.
Bob picked up the Mandolin and soon joined in jam sessions at the local pub (The Silver Tongued Devil Saloon!!!). He performed for several years with regionally known groups in Colorado.
In digging into the new found music Bob kind of accidentally landed a volunteer job as host of the Bluegrass Show on KRCC public radio at The Colorado College. After a couple years on the air the station manager commended his success in rising to top rated program on the station.
Now living in Mt. Pleasant, SC, Bob performs with several regional groups. He has a regular Tuesday night gig with Bob Sachs & The Maniax that is great fun and totally spontaneous music. He traveled to New England to perform with Southern Rail for 11 years.
"Bob is an award-winning mandolinist who exhibits absolute authority on his instrument. His playing is aggressive, clean, and lightning-fast. His rich bass vocals are a powerful addition to quartet harmonies."
A veteran musician of over 25 years, Bob has performed and recorded with such folks as Roger Bellow & The Drifting Troubadours, The Blue Dogs , Guitarist David Greer, Mandolinist & Fiddler David Harvey, Singer/Songwriter Carroll Brown , Boston Based Southern Rail , Country Artists Melba Montgomery, David Ball, Red Rector and many others.
After 20 years playing on and off a full time schedule, Bob now has a "day job." Luckily, he still makes plenty of time to perform the music he loves.

Sounds Like:
Sounds Like?!?!?! I've always thought that I wanted to sound like ME! That's what makes musicians worth seeking out and listening to. To me, good musicians have their own "voice." There are influences of course, but other than just for a single fun gig, I'd rather not sound too much like anybody else.
The musical genre may be Bluegrass, Country, Swing, Jazz, Irish, Olde Time, Light Rock, Latin, Gypsy, or whatever, sometimes even a mix, but I love to play with folks who make their own mark on the music!
